What the club says: A classic heathland course of Championship status (Par 71) set amongst heather, pine trees and silver birch. The Championship course (6754 yards) has two loops of nine holes. An Open Championship Final Qualifying venue on eight occasions and a Senior Open Championship Final Qualifying venue currently.

Stunning but brutally difficult course

It's easy to see why this was a loong-standing Open qualifying course. A classic heathland which was bone-dry and rockhard when we played it. I'm not sure I have every played on firmer greens which made it nearly impossibly to get up and down if you missed the many raised greens anywhere other than below the hole. The layout is fantastic and condition was great. Greens were super quick and treacherous, almost too much so but we did play it the afternoon after the women's Scottish matchplay had been staged in the morning. It is hard to lose a golf ball with the tree-lined fairways but even without that, it is one of the most difficult golf courses I have ever played. I am despreate to go back and give it another go.

Trees, well-guarded greens and a variety of dog legs all combine to produce a parkland course that you have to plot your way around. Tight lines off the tee will be rewarded on fast-running heathland turf but beware of running off into heather or tree roots. Holes would be more memorable if there were more variations in altitude (the terrain is flat) or panorama (all holes are tree-lined) but these are minor gripes for a course very much in the Blairgowrie mould. The bunkers had perhaps too much sand and the early season greens were a little scuffed and seemed less than true, but I'd hope a visit later in the summer would see an improvement. I played with a member and, despite the course being fully booked, pace of play was excellent for a busy Friday afternoon, with no sense of the course being crowded.
